The art of hand-blown glass or vidrio soplado has diversified throughout the world, yet it is in the state of Jalisco, Mexico, where allegedly more pieces are crafted by talented artisans with techniques passed down from generation to generation. Blown glass art is said to have originated in present-day Syria during the Roman Empire, which is how it arrived in Italy, where blown glass art developed various styles. At first, the focus was on color and design, then came the introduction of new techniques that resulted in greater transparency and thus fragility, which were highly admired. Thus clear glass items became more valued over tinted glass. Blown glass techniques made it possible for a greater number of products to be crafted.
